Crossword Genius

Farewell remark respecting a Royal Academician (8)

Ross

I believe the answer is:

sayonara

I'm a little stuck... Click here to teach me more about this clue!

'farewell' is the definition.
(sayonara is a kind of farewell)

'remark respecting a royal academician' is the wordplay.
'remark' becomes 'say'' (to remark something is to say it).
'respecting a royal' becomes 'ona' (I can't justify this - if you can you should give a lot more credence to this answer).
'academician' becomes 'RA' (member of the Royal Academy of Arts).
'say'+'ona'+'ra'='SAYONARA'

Can you help me to learn more?

(Other definitions for sayonara that I've seen before include "So long" , "Goodbye (Jap.)" , "Japanese goodbye" , "Japanese farewell" , "Goodbye or farewell in Japan" .)

Want a hint initially instead of a full solution? Install my app